Why Local Trust Drives Long-Term Success for Community Businesses

Every thriving community business shares one essential advantage that cannot be purchased through advertising alone: local trust. While promotions, digital campaigns, and attractive branding may attract attention, lasting success depends on the confidence customers place in a business over time. Trust encourages people to return, recommend services to friends, and support businesses during both prosperous and challenging periods. Community businesses that earn trust become part of everyday life rather than simply another place to shop. They build meaningful relationships through reliability, honesty, and genuine involvement in the neighborhoods they serve. As markets become increasingly competitive, businesses that prioritize trust create stronger customer loyalty and establish a foundation that supports sustainable growth. Real Leadership Happens After the Applause Ends

Every great leader can deliver a polished speech, present a strong vision, and answer prepared questions with confidence. However, those moments alone rarely create lasting relationships. Community trust develops when people see leaders as approachable individuals rather than distant figures. While public presentations matter, the conversations that happen after the event often shape lasting impressions. People remember who stayed to listen, who asked thoughtful questions, and who cared enough to continue the discussion once the microphones turned off. Moreover, trust grows through repeated personal interactions instead of one memorable performance. A short conversation in the parking lot or near the exit often feels more authentic because it lacks the pressure of a formal setting. As a result, people become more willing to share honest concerns, personal stories, and practical ideas. The Living Room Test: How Community Trust Signals Shape Local Business Success

Life in every neighborhood depends on trust, and Community Trust Signals become visible through daily actions instead of big promises. People naturally recommend businesses that make them feel respected, welcomed, and valued. The living room test offers a simple way to understand this idea. If someone would feel comfortable inviting a business owner into their home, that business has likely earned real confidence. Local trust grows through honest conversations, dependable service, and consistent behavior. Every positive experience becomes another story that neighbors share with each other . Those conversations influence future customers far more than flashy promotions. Strong relationships develop because people remember how they were treated. Businesses that care about every interaction often become trusted names within their communities. Trust grows one experience at a time, creating lasting connections that support long-term success.
